A MAN is critically injured after being shot in Chalk Farm last night.
Police were called to reports of the shooting in Haverstock Hill, close to the junction of Prince of Wales Road, at around 9.40pm.
Officers and paramedics attended the scene where they found a man, aged in his 20s, who had suffered serious injuries.
The victim was rushed to a central London hospital for treatment.
His condition is believed to be critical but stable.
A spokeswoman for Camden Police said: “Officers from Camden attended the scene.
“No arrests have been made and enquiries continue.”
